A Resolution of the City Commission approving the commissioning of an original musical score for use by the city and for integration with the city’s centennial inspired virtual/digital experience, Gables GO!, in partnership with the University of Miami and Frost Symphony Orchestra; and authorizing the city manager or their designee and City Attorney to negotiate an agreement with the parties (unanimously recommended by the Cultural Development Board approval/denial vote: 6 to 0).

The City Commission has consistently championed the arts and fostered innovation, leading to the creation of a world-class public art collection and the city's recognition as an award-winning, globally renowned Smart City.
In honor of the city’s centennial, and in collaboration between the Historical Resources & Cultural Arts and Innovation & Technology departments, a digital/virtual “path” titled “Cables GO!” is being developed for thirty+ cultural sites highlighting the city’s history, identity, and artworks.
Through a dedicated web-based application, each site will include a selection of experiences such as images, text, holograms, interactive information sharing/gathering, and music.
While content like images and information may pre-exist, music that is site-specific and aligns with the aesthetic of Coral Gables requires the expertise of an artist skilled in composing musical scores that resonate both literally and figuratively.
About the project:
The concept for commissioning a city score is to compose an original musical score in honor of the city’s centennial that will play at different cultural sites, creating a unique atmosphere for each location.
This original composition will apply integrated live data to prompt a unique and innovative experience each time the experience is activated.
